Akon City, an ambitious $6 billion project in Senegal, has recently been abandoned after seven frustrating years marked by missed deadlines and financial turmoil. The Senegalese government has reclaimed almost all the land, leaving only a partially constructed Welcome Center in its wake. Community sentiment is rife with disappointment as many locals express their harsh views on the project's viability.

The Dream Turns Sour

Originally envisioned as a futuristic hub, Akon City aimed to reflect the cultural aspirations of a real-life Wakanda. However, the failure of the Akoin cryptocurrency severely hindered its funding and prospects. Local communities now see the site as an empty plot, with grazing goats symbolizing lost hope.

"Farmers who volunteered their land got screwed," lamented one community member.

What Went Wrong?

Several factors contributed to Akon City's demise:

  • Financial Setbacks: Continuous funding shortfalls stalled the project.

  • Reclaimed Land: The government intervened after progress became nonexistent.

  • Local Disillusionment: Once-supportive voices now echo feelings of betrayal.
